Our country house 'La Gioia', mostly rebuilt and completely renovated in the late 1990s, is situated in the midst of the gently sloping hills of the Marche. Whenever possible we have followed the ways of construction typical of the area. Downstairs you will find a generously equipped kitchen, spacious living and dining room and a bathroom with shower and washing machine. Upstairs there are four bedrooms (one double, three twins that can be doubles), a second open living room with fireplace and two bathrooms (each of which has a shower). Located downstairs in the addition and accessible from the covered patio is one more double bedroom with a little en-suite bathroom with shower. The garden holds an old covered well, along with many trees. You can park your car right by the house.

The house is situated in the hilly countryside of Castel Colonna, a small medieval town. The property lies in a quiet valley, close to fields and trees, in a very peaceful an serene setting. Small shops an restaurants in little villages around us are some 4 km away. Senigallia, a nice sea-side town facing the Adria, is at 12 km and has every shopping facility you may need. This is also where you can enjoy the sun and the sea on one of the finest Italian beaches, the 'velvet beach', stroll around the weekly market on Thursday, do your shopping and lunch or dine in one of the many welcoming restaurants.

Exceptional cultural sights like San Marino, Macerata, Jesi, beautiful Urbino to name just a few are within easy reach by car and perfect for a day-trip. For those more in search of the natural beauty of our landscape we recommend a visit to Grotte di Frasassi, Conero and a hike in the Sibillini Mountains.

Suggested sights: We love to stroll around the little old towns in the countryside, built on top of hills and surrounded by their old walls, like Jesi, Corinaldo or San Leo, just to name 3 out of hundreds. Senigallia and Fano are nice seaside-towns, suitable for bathing, dining and shopping. Be sure to visit the Grotte di Frasassi, for a one hour tour through a large cave-system discovered around 1970. Hiking in the lower mountains around the Grotte di Frasassi is a wonderful way to discover a part of Italy where nobody else usually goes. The monastery of Fonte Avellana is a perfect place to spend a few hours in the mountains, visiting a structure that almost hasn't changed in the last 800 years, together with its library that holds thousands of really old books. There is a beautiful 4-hour hike close to the monastery too. Another highlight is the Monte Conero, south of Ancona, where the coastline is atypically steep for the Adria, and beaches are small and romantic.

Typical products: In the Marche agriculture has always been an important source of income. Wheat, sunflowers, grapes, artichokes and olives are typical for the region, as well as honey and pecorino cheese (especially 'formaggio di fossa'). A famous white wine is 'Verdicchio dei Castelli di Jesi' produced by many small family-run businesses around Jesi, for example by Zaccagnini in Staffolo, where you can buy your wine directly where it grows. Another wine is 'Lacrima di Morro d'Alba', delicious red wine, produced in such small quantities that it is almost not exported. And of course there is any kind of fresh fish sold in the daily fish-market in Senigallia. In Monterado, 5km from the house, you can buy delicious fresh pasta every workday, and on Saturdays there is Porchetta (pork roast) freshly made and stuffed with herbs and garlic.
